Fig and Honey Spread

Ripe figs and floral honey make an elegant spread that’s less sweet than traditional jams. A touch of lemon brightens the flavors and keeps the color vibrant.

Ingredients

  • 2 lbs fresh figs, stemmed and chopped
  • 1 cup honey
  • 1/2 cup sugar
  • 1/4 cup lemon juice
  • Zest of one lemon

Instructions

  1. Combine figs, honey, sugar, lemon juice and zest in a saucepan and let sit for 15 minutes to draw out juices.
  2. Cook over medium heat, stirring frequently, until the figs soften and the mixture thickens, 30–40 minutes.
  3. Mash with a fork for a rustic texture or purée for a smoother spread.
  4. Spoon hot spread into sterilized jars, leaving 1/4-inch headspace. Wipe rims and seal.
  5. Process in boiling water for 10 minutes. Let cool before storing.

This spread shines on a cheese platter—try it with blue cheese or Brie—or slathered on buttered toast.
